We went to Paradise Beach about 2 weeks ago. We took a cab ride there from port for 4 of us. Ride in was $19 and the ride out was $13. I think it depends on supply and demand.

 

We got to the beach about 10. We were not planning on staying long and planned to be back at the ship for lunch. The beach was not busy at all. There were tons of empty chairs.

 

When we arrived, they told us there was no charge for the chairs and umbrellas, but they just ask that that you buy a few drinks. This was not qualified in ANY way (i.e a per person minimum). In hindsight we should have asked. Anyhow, we took up one chair with our stuff. We declined the water toys. Our kids are 2 and 4 and just wanted to build sandcastles. I don't drink and we had sippy cups for the kids with water. The guy tried to sell DH a bucket of beers. He told him that I didn't drink and that he would not be able to drink that much, so he would just order them as he wanted them. He ended up having about 3 beers and then it was time for us to head back to the ship ... so he asked to settle up his bill, and they tried to ding us for $20 pp minimum. DH refused to pay, and they told us to leave (we were planning on leaving anyway).

 

I have no problem with their pp charge .... I just wish they had been upfront about this. I had posted about this at carnival's site, and others said they were charged $10 pp. Others said no charge at all, so I dont' think they are consistent with their policy.

 

The beach was beautiful and I would go back there again .... but next time I'll be prepared and order $20 of food and drink per person.
